Jours de cirque

The ÉCQ steps outside its walls—come join us!

Jours de cirque means it’s the time of year when students from the École de cirque de Québec’s advanced circus arts program take their skills beyond the school walls. They showcase their talents and accomplishments to the public in a series of shows and performances, indoors and outdoors, throughout Quebec City. Éclats de cirque, two street shows (second-year DEC-DEE)

Presented from May 20 to June 8.

The Éclats de cirque, formerly known as Zoom Cirque, are outdoor performances created by and performed by second-year students in the Higher Education Circus Arts program at the École de cirque de Québec.

Each show is the result of a four-week intensive workshop, led by a dedicated director for each group. Lasting about 30 minutes, these short performances offer students a unique opportunity to dive into collaborative creation and experience the spontaneous energy of street performance.

Designed for public spaces, these short shows aim to captivate, amaze and make contemporary circus shine beyond traditional walls.

High School Circus Studies shows

Title: Disaster in the Cathedral + After the End
Date: Saturday, May 16, 7:00 p.m.

The end-of-year performance by students in the Circus-High School Program, a circus-focused program offered in partnership with La Seigneurie and Cardinal Roy high schools, aims to provide the Quebec City public and the students’ families with an opportunity to showcase the talents of all high school cohorts through two performances.

A first 30-minute show featuring students from grades 1 and 2, and a second 45-minute show by students from grades 4, 5, and 6.
